 Fill Line Data Logger

 

Challenge

  • Issues with leaking of metered dose inhalers (MDI) due to suspected filling line issues
  • Need to accurately measure critical parameters as container is processed

Solution

  • Design monitoring device based upon form factor for 120 dose MDI
  • Design electronics and sensors to fit inside MDI
  • Data can be collected and downloaded to spreadsheet via docking cradle

Value

  • Identified correlation of equipment settings with line performance
  • Allowed for optimization of equipment
  • Avoided failure of lots and cost of API

 Impaction Plate & Stage Auto Rinser

Challenge

  • Manual rinsing and collection of samples introduced high variability in analysis
  • Very labor intensive process

Solution

  • Design and build automated system to rinse and prepare samples for HPLC
  • Accommodates standard stages and plates
  • Ease of training and use by lab staff

Value

  • Automated system allowed technicians to perform more value-added tasks
  • Increased lab throughput by >3-5x per day
  • Reduced variability in results due to human variability in sample preparation

 Powder Fill Uniformity

Challenge

  • Variability in manual separation and weighing of individual sealed cavities from foil strip
  • Tedious and labor intensive

Solution

  • Automated system to evaluate filling uniformity
  • Uses laser sensors to accurately align blister cavities with punch
  • Precision load cells accurately weigh mass of each individual cavity

Value

  • Testing automated; less labor required
  • Reduced time and variability in measurement
  • Immediately evaluate equipment performance

 Polystyrene Bead Processing

 

Challenge

  • Collection of beads in each well “pool”
  • Separate each beads into individual well to allow cleavage and further characterization
  • Very slow manual activity

Solution

  • Automated system to pick and place beads
  • Custom probe to verify bead is present
  • Integrate with commercial small scale XYZ system

Value

  • Unattended operation
  • Reduce processing rate from 3-5 minute to 5 seconds per bead
